A Tour Through India's Top Attractions

Planning a trip to India? Get ready to be enchanted by its colorful culture, mesmerizing landscapes, and historical sites. From the snow-capped Himalayas to the sun-kissed beaches, India has something to enthrall every traveler. Here are the top 10 tourist places you absolutely shouldn't miss:

  • Taj Mahal, Agra: The epitome of love and architectural mastery, this white marble mausoleum is a must-see for any visitor to India.
  • Varanasi, Uttar Pradesh: Embark on a spiritual journey in this ancient city on the banks of the Ganges River, where traditions and rituals resonate.
  • Jaipur, Rajasthan: Known as the "Pink City," Jaipur is a festival of palaces, forts, and bustling bazaars.
  • Kerala Backwaters: Float through tranquil backwaters in Kerala, surrounded by lush landscapes.
  • Goa: The beach paradise, Goa offers golden beaches, vibrant nightlife, and mouthwatering seafood.
  • Darjeeling, West Bengal: Revel in the beauty of the Himalayas in Darjeeling, famous for its tea plantations and panoramic views.
  • Mumbai, Maharashtra: The city that never sleeps, Mumbai is a thriving hub of Bollywood, history, and modern designs.
  • Amritsar, Punjab: Visit the Golden Temple, a sacred site for Sikhs and a symbol of peace and harmony.
  • Ladakh, Jammu & Kashmir: Discover a high-altitude desert landscape in Ladakh, with its stunning monasteries and awe-inspiring scenery.
  • Hampi, Karnataka: Explore the ruins of a historical Vijayanagara empire, sprawled across valleys and offering a glimpse into India's rich past.

Unveiling South India: A Guide to its Best Tourist Spots

South India is an enchanting land of rich culture, breathtaking landscapes, and vibrant traditions. From the majestic mountains of the Western Ghats to the sun-kissed beaches of Goa, this region offers a plethora of experiences for every kind of traveler.

Begin your journey in Tamil Nadu, home to the ancient temples of Madurai and Thanjavur, or explore Kerala's picturesque backwaters on a traditional houseboat. For those seeking adventure, Karnataka offers trekking trails in Coorg and wildlife safaris in Bandipur National Park.

Savor in the delicious South Indian cuisine, a culinary treat that will tantalize your taste buds. Don't miss out on trying local specialties like idli, dosa, and vada, accompanied with fragrant sambar and coconut chutney.
